Renowned for top-tier strength per unit weight, carbon fiber tubes excel in demanding roles requiring robustness and lighter builds

Manufactured by embedding aligned carbon fibers into a polymeric resin matrix, these tubes form a strong composite material

High-quality aligned carbon strands grant exceptional tensile performance and stiffness, and the lightweight resin helps minimize mass

This singular set of properties enables engineers to design structures that are highly robust yet unusually light

Carbon fiber tubing is applied in aerospace, automotive, athletic equipment and healthcare device construction

Aerospace use of carbon fiber tubes results in reduced airframe weight for fuselages and wings, raising fuel efficiency and performance

For the automotive sector, carbon fiber tubes support lighter suspension and chassis components that enhance driving dynamics and cut weight

Advanced carbon fiber plates with outstanding stiffness and toughness

The plates’ notable stiffness makes them appropriate where high load capacity is required

Constructed with carbon fiber reinforcements within a polymer matrix, these plates show superior resistance to bending and shape change

Impact resilience stems from carbon fibers’ capacity to dissipate energy, giving plates toughness without brittle fracture

Weight reduction techniques using carbon fiber tubes and plate technologies

Carbon fiber allows design of much lighter components while retaining essential strength and stiffness characteristics

Tubes are commonly used where high stiffness and low mass are priorities, for example bicycle frames and wind turbine blades

Plates are chosen for their stiffness and impact resistance in aerospace structural parts where stability and load capacity are critical
